Paul Yi wrote:
Thank you all for the kind input....
I think I'll go for the ZE21 ....



If you're shooting it on a Canon, Paul, that's the best choice anyway. The 19 vII fouls Canon FF mirrors without something getting shaved. And the first version, which doesn't foul the mirror, is good, but introduces distortion issues (like the gull-wing distortion) not evident in the second version.

'Native mounts, auto-aperture, new coatings.'
'The newer 21 is better.'

Unfortunately - since few have the chance or the inclination to buy the Contax version - no.

The glass selection is doubtless very different:

"Lens cross-section of the Distagon 2.8/21 for the Contax SLR, a relatively complex lens with 15 elements in 13 groups. However, it had no aspherical surfaces. Its performance, particularly the perfect correction of lateral chromatic aberration, was achieved solely by the combination of very special (and expensive) high-index glass types with glass types displaying extremely high anomalous partial dispersion."

You can view the astounding MTF chart on page 6 of this document:

http://blogs.zeiss.com/photo/en/wp-content/uploads/2011/12/en_CLB41_Nasse_LensNames_Distagon.pdf

There are very good reasons why the market retains such incredible value in the Contax version.
